Kinds of Headphones
Headphones can usually be categorized into several types, each developed to deal with unique requirements and preferences. Here is a breakdown of the numerous types:
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|---|
Over-Ear | Headphones that include the entire ear | Outstanding sound quality, good sound seclusion | Bulky, less portable |
On-Ear | Headphones that rest on top of the ears | Lightweight and portable, comfortable for short usage | Less noise isolation, can be unpleasant for long wear |
In-Ear (Earbuds) | Small headphones that fit inside the ear canal | Highly portable, typically good noise seclusion | Sound quality varies considerably, can be uncomfortable for some |
Wireless | Headphones that link through Bluetooth | Liberty of motion, no tangled wires | Battery life can be a concern, prospective connectivity problems |
Noise-Canceling | Headphones that utilize technology to obstruct ambient sounds | Great for travel, boosts focus in loud environments | Typically more expensive, may need to charge |
Sports | Developed for exercises | Safe and secure fit, sweat-resistant | Sound quality might be secondary to sturdiness |
Selecting the Right Headphones
When selecting headphones, think about elements such as sound quality, convenience, resilience, and price. Here are some elements to assist guide your decision:
Purpose: Identify how you mean to utilize the headphones. Will they be used for commuting, exercising, or gaming? This will help narrow down your alternatives.
Sound Quality: Look for headphones with good frequency reaction and bass performance if you're an audiophile. It's useful to read reviews or listen to demo units in-store.
Comfort: Ensure the headphones you pick are comfortable, specifically if you prepare to wear them for prolonged durations. Consider padding for on-ear and over-ear models.
Toughness: Check for build quality and products. Will they withstand day-to-day wear and tear? Try to find warranties or guarantees used by the producer.
Features: Depending on your needs, consider features such as sound cancellation, wireless connection, and integrated voice assistants.
